2013-07-12 4 views
0

Я работаю с PostgreSQL 9.2 и скриптом bash. У меня проблема.PostgreSQL Command fom bash script

Мои БД TestDB, Имя таблицы является конфигурации

и мой Баш код

sudo -u postgres psql -c "select count(*) from public.config where var_name='url'" 

результат

ОШИБКА: отношение "public.config" не есть

Может кто-нибудь мне помочь?

+1

Судо -u Postgres PSQL TestDB -c «SELECT COUNT (*) из config, где var_name = 'url' " – cptPH

+0

Спасибо большое. Он отлично работает – mindia

+2

@Patrick. Вы должны сделать ответ, чтобы его можно было принять. –

ответ

3
sudo -u postgres psql TestDB -c "select count(*) from config where var_name='url' 

База данных не хватает, так что вы выполнили команду в Postgres БД, где вы, вероятно, не имеют этой таблицы ;-)